Title: Karlfried Wedemeyer: Innovator in Polyurethane Chemistry

Introduction: Karlfried Wedemeyer, a prolific inventor based in Cologne, Germany, has made significant contributions to the field of chemistry with an impressive portfolio of 65 patents. His innovative work primarily focuses on developing new materials and processes that have practical applications in various industries.

Latest Patents: Among Karlfried's most recent achievements are two noteworthy patents. The first, "Diaminoarylsulfones useful for the preparation of polyurethane elastomers," introduces diaminoarylsulfones with specific chemical properties that serve as vital chain extenders in the formulation of polyurethane elastomers. The second patent, "Process for nucleus-chlorination of aromatic hydrocarbons," describes a method for chlorinating aromatic hydrocarbons in the nucleus utilizing Friedel-Crafts catalysts and thiazepines as co-catalysts, demonstrating his expertise in organic chemistry.

Career Highlights: Throughout his career, Karlfried has worked with prominent companies, such as Bayer Aktiengesellschaft and Agfa-Gevaert AG.
